

She was a hairstylist for 50 years and owned Suzi’s Hairworks for 43 years. She and her colleagues travelled to many hair shows and competitions. She retired from Salon 5021 in 2016. She was a true role model who had tremendous work ethic. She especially enjoyed mentoring new stylists in her salon. Suzi was known for her annual Christmas parties where she had the annual flying of the "free bird". She had a passion for animals and was fond of watching Pitbulls and Parolees while doing crossword puzzles and coloring books. After retirement, Suzi enjoyed spending time as an avid reader and watching her shows, General Hospital and the girls on The View. Suzi took tremendous pride in her children and grandchildren and is survived by her beloved pet Yorkie, Rosie.
Suzi was preceded in death by her mother and stepfather, Martha and Marion Klipsch; father, Hal Pittman; and brothers, Van Pittman and Jim Adkins.
She is survived by her children, Eric Dewig, Christine Rainey, and Julie Hodges; grandchildren, Samantha Ward (Stevan), Isaac Rainey, and Olivia Hodges; great grandchildren, Beth, Daniel, Myles, and Charlie Ward; sister, Melissa Ferguson (Gary); and many nieces and nephews.
